:root{color-scheme:light;--primary:hsla(191,54%,44%,1);--primary-100:hsla(192,42%,95%,1);--primary-200:hsla(191,41%,84%,1);--primary-600:hsla(191,80%,30%,1);--white:hsla(0,0%,100%,1);--neutral-offWhite:hsla(240,12%,97%,1);--neutral-stroke:hsla(0,0%,96%,1);--neutral-offGray:hsla(0,0%,93%,1);--neutral-lightGray:hsla(0,0%,85%,1);--neutral-outline:hsla(0,0%,40%,1);--neutral-gray:hsla(240,4%,9%,1);--neutral-black:hsla(0,0%,9%,1);--error:#ea3829;--size-2:0.5rem;--size-3:1rem;--size-4:1.25rem;--size-5:1.5rem;--size-6:1.75rem;--size-7:2rem;--size-7-5:2.5rem;--size-8:3rem;--size-9:4rem;--size-10:5rem;--size-11:7.5rem;--size-12:8rem;--size-13:10rem;--size-fluid-1:clamp(0.5rem,1vw,1rem);--size-fluid-2:clamp(1rem,2vw,1.5rem);--size-fluid-3:clamp(1.5rem,3vw,2rem);--size-fluid-4:clamp(2rem,4vw,3rem);--size-fluid-5:clamp(4rem,5vw,5rem);--size-fluid-6:clamp(5rem,7vw,7.5rem);--size-fluid-7:clamp(7.5rem,10vw,10rem);--size-fluid-8:clamp(10rem,20vw,15rem);--size-fluid-9:clamp(15rem,30vw,20rem);--size-fluid-10:clamp(20rem,40vw,30rem);--size-xxs:240px;--size-xs:360px;--size-sm:480px;--size-md:768px;--size-lg:1024px;--size-xl:1440px;--size-xxl:1920px;--max-content:1280px;--border-radius-sm:16px;--border-radius-md:28px;--border-radius-lg:40px;--border-radius-xl:48px;--font-weight-regular:400;--font-weight-bold:700;--rmdp-primary:var(--primary-600);--rmdp-secondary:#87ad92;--rmdp-shadow:#87ad92;--rmdp-today:var(--neutral-offWhite);--rmdp-hover:var(--primary);--rmdp-deselect:var(--primary-600)}*,:after,:before{box-sizing:border-box;margin:0}body,html{max-width:100vw;font-family:var(--mabry-pro);color:var(--neutral-gray);background-color:var(--white);accent-color:var(--primary-600)}body{min-height:100vh}@media(max-width:720px){body{min-height:unset}}a{font-size:var(--size-3);line-height:1.25;color:inherit;text-decoration:none}a,button{letter-spacing:2%}button{line-height:1.4;font-size:var(--size-4);font-family:var(--mabry-pro);cursor:pointer}@media(max-width:600px){button{font-size:var(--size-3);line-height:1.4;letter-spacing:2%;font-size:1rem}}input,select{line-height:1.4;letter-spacing:2%;font-size:var(--size-4);background-color:var(--white);cursor:pointer;border:none;padding-block:var(--size-2);color:var(--neutral-black);font-family:var(--mabry-pro)}@media(max-width:600px){input,select{font-size:var(--size-3)}}input:focus,select:focus{outline:none}@media(max-width:600px){input,select{line-height:1.4;letter-spacing:2%;font-size:1rem}}input[type=radio]{background-color:var(--white);color:#fff}input[type=radio]:focus{box-shadow:0 0 5px 0 var(--primary-600)}input:-webkit-autofill,input:-webkit-autofill:active,input:-webkit-autofill:focus,input:-webkit-autofill:hover{-webkit-box-shadow:0 0 0 30px var(--white) inset!important;-webkit-text-fill-color:var(--neutral-gray)!important;background-clip:content-box!important}.container{--padding:var(--size-8);width:min(100vw - var(--padding),var(--max-content));margin-inline:auto}@media(max-width:820px){.container{--padding:calc(var(--size-7-5) * 2)}}@media(max-width:600px){.container{width:100vw;margin:0}}.row{display:flex;list-style:none;padding:0;margin:0;gap:var(--size-5);align-items:center}.flex__between{display:flex;justify-content:space-between}.calendar{border-radius:16px;padding-inline:var(--size-3);-webkit-margin-after:var(--size-3);margin-block-end:var(--size-3);top:var(--size-3)}.calendar .rmdp-wrapper{border:1px solid var(--rmdp-secondary);box-shadow:none}.calendar .rmdp-header-values{color:var(--neutral-black);font-weight:600}.calendar .rmdp-panel-body li{background-color:var(--rmdp-primary);box-shadow:0 0 2px var(--rmdp-secondary)}.calendar .rmdp-week-day{color:var(--neutral-black);font-weight:600}.calendar .rmdp-day.rmdp-deactive{color:var(--rmdp-secondary)}.calendar .rmdp-range{background-color:var(--rmdp-primary);box-shadow:0 0 3px var(--rmdp-shadow)}.calendar .rmdp-arrow{border:solid var(--neutral-black);border-width:0 2px 2px 0}.calendar .rmdp-arrow-container:hover{background-color:#fff;box-shadow:none}.calendar .rmdp-arrow-container:hover .rmdp-arrow{border-color:var(--primary-600)}.calendar .rmdp-panel-body::-webkit-scrollbar-thumb{background:var(--rmdp-primary)}.calendar .rmdp-day.rmdp-today span{background-color:var(--neutral-offGray);color:var(--neutral-gray);border:.5px solid var(--neutral-gray)}.calendar .rmdp-rtl .rmdp-panel{border-left:unset;border-right:1px solid var(--rmdp-secondary)}.calendar .rmdp-day.rmdp-selected span:not(.highlight){background-color:var(--primary-600);box-shadow:none}.calendar .rmdp-day:not(.rmdp-day-hidden) span:hover{background-color:var(--primary)!important}.calendar .b-deselect{color:var(--rmdp-deselect);background-color:#fff}.calendar .rmdp-action-button{color:var(--rmdp-primary)}.calendar .rmdp-button:not(.rmdp-action-button){background-color:var(--rmdp-primary)}.calendar .rmdp-button:not(.rmdp-action-button):hover{background-color:var(--rmdp-deselect)}.displayNone{display:none}.link{color:var(--primary-600);text-decoration:underline}.link:hover{color:var(--primary);text-decoration:none}.loader{display:grid;place-items:center}@media(max-width:600px){.loader{display:block;margin:auto;padding-block:var(--size-5)}}.car{height:50px;display:grid;place-items:center}.car__body{animation:shake .2s ease-in-out infinite alternate}.car__line{transform-origin:center right;stroke-dasharray:22;animation:line .8s ease-in-out infinite;animation-fill-mode:both}.car__line--top{animation-delay:0s}.car__line--middle{animation-delay:.2s}.car__line--bottom{animation-delay:.4s}@keyframes shake{0%{transform:translateY(-1%)}to{transform:translateY(2%)}}@keyframes line{0%{stroke-dashoffset:22}25%{stroke-dashoffset:22}50%{stroke-dashoffset:0}51%{stroke-dashoffset:0}80%{stroke-dashoffset:-22}to{stroke-dashoffset:-22}}.rmdp-action-button{font-size:16px!important;font-weight:600!important;float:unset!important;background-color:var(--white)!important;min-height:48px!important}